English adjective: valid | |||
1. | valid well grounded in logic or truth or having legal force | ||
Samples | A valid inference. A valid argument. A valid contract. | ||
Similar | binding, effectual, legal, legitimate, logical, reasoned, sound, sound, validated, well-grounded | ||
See also | legitimate, reasonable, sensible | ||
Antonyms | invalid | ||
2. | valid still legally acceptable | ||
Samples | The license is still valid. | ||
Similar | unexpired | ||
Antonyms | expired | ||
